Abstract

Disclosed is a data transmission device of variable communication capacity that can set bands and set line communication capacities according to users' requests, and can automatically determine usable lines. The data transmission device includes: a transmission device having a transmission unit connected to N (N > 1) transmission lines; a reception device having a reception unit connected to N reception lines; and negotiation units connected to both the transmission unit and the reception unit. The transmission unit converts transmission data of parallel bits into a data array with one to N trains that is different in the number of data trains depending on specified transmission capacity. The reception unit synthesizes reception data trains inputted from one to N reception lines determined by specified reception capacity, of the N reception lines. The negotiation unit of the transmission side sends line use / disuse information to the negotiation unit of the reception side so that both the transmission unit and the reception unit select identical lines.

Description

[0001] priority claim [0002] This application claims priority from Japanese application JP 2005-064751 filed March 9, 2005, the contents of which are hereby incorporated by reference into this application. technical field [0003] The present invention relates to a variable communication capacity data transmission device. More particularly, the present invention relates to a variable communication in which a virtual transmission path is formed through a plurality of transmission lines, and a transmission rate is changed by automatically negotiating the number of transmission lines between a sending end and a receiving end according to a requested bandwidth and a connection status of the transmission lines capacity data transmission equipment. Background technique [0004] Most long-distance transmission networks use serial transmission, and increase the transmission speed by increasing the transmission clock frequency.
